Fall In Love Again With The American Classic ON GOLDEN POND
by Julie Musbach
- Dec 11, 2018
Bristol Riverside Theatre starts the new year with the American classic On Golden Pond, by Ernest Thompson, running January 22 - February 10. The humorous and heartwarming play is directed by Bristol Riverside Theatre's founding director Susan D. Atkinson. Previews begin Tuesday, January 22, with opening night set for Thursday, January 24.

Bristol Riverside Theatre Presents TIME STANDS STILL
by Stephi Wild
- Jan 2, 2018
Bristol Riverside Theatre heads into the new year with Donald Margulies' Pulitzer Prize-winning classic Time Stands Still January 23-February 11. Directed by Susan D. Atkinson, the ensemble cast includes Laura Giknis, Eleanor Handley, Michael Satow, and Danny Vaccaro.
BWW Interview: Michael Tucker and Jill Eikenberry and the NJ Rep ALL ABOUT EVE FESTIVAL
by Marina Kennedy
- Sep 27, 2017
New Jersey Repertory Company (NJ Rep) will present a week-long arts event, the 'ALL ABOUT EVE FESTIVAL OF THE ARTS' from October 1st to October 8th.The festival will be inaugurating their new West End Arts Center at 132 West End Avenue and will feature Theatre Brut with 28 short plays. Michael Tucker and Jill Eikenberry's play, 'Pittsburgh' will be a part of the festival.

Bristol Riverside Theatre to Continue Season with Neil Simon's RUMORS
by Tyler Peterson
- Feb 1, 2016
Bristol Riverside Theatre continues the 2015-2016 Season with the Neil Simon farce Rumors, running March 22-April 17. Directed by Keith Baker, the ensemble cast features Bruce Graham, Leonard Haas, Eleanor Handley, Valerie Leonard, Sean Thompson, Jo Twiss, Danny Vaccaro, Jessica Wagner, and Paul Weagraff.
